Why it matters
Meta's strategy of open-sourcing foundational models (Llama) is explicitly designed to create a diverse ecosystem of fine-tuned, specialized applications. This enables companies to build proprietary vertical applications on Meta's infrastructure.
Investment implication
Suppliers of fine-tuning infrastructure, inference optimization, and vertical SaaS applications built on Llama will benefit. Companies offering fine-tuning-as-a-service, inference acceleration (e.g., quantization, distillation tools), and domain-specific Llama variants should see opportunities.
